Police busy during May long weekend
Local RCMP were out in full force in the surrounding area over the May long weekend, enhancing its patrol in local campgrounds like Red Sands and Furlong Bay.
The police dealt with a number of incidents stemming from the Red Sands area.
While the detachment says there were no major incidents, it received 137 calls during weekend, which is nine more than last year's May long weekend.
There were four calls related to impaired operation of a motor vehicle, 36 liquor-related calls, and seven calls were related to noise.
The number of prisoners was up as well, 56 this year compared to 42 from last year.
